Noun — A lover, especially one involved in a secret or illicit romantic or sexual relationship.

A literary, slightly old-fashioned word — most people today would just say "lover" or "affair partner."
Etymology
From Old French par amour, "by/through love" — originally an adverbial phrase meaning "passionately" that was later reinterpreted as a noun meaning "beloved person."
